Main Road is in Highbridge and in Sedgemoor district. TA9 3DN is located in the Highbridge and Burnham Marine elect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Bridgwater and West Somerset.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is Main Road dangerous?

In 2023, 121 crimes were reported near Main Road . 56%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of TA9 3DN.

The percentage of retired residents living in TA9 3DN area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 39%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
